Terrorist Attack in Turkey:
A terrorist attack occurred at the Turkish Aerospace Industries (TUSAŞ) facility in Ankara, resulting in 4 confirmed deaths and 14 injuries, with 3 individuals reported in critical condition.
The assailants, armed with firearms and possibly carrying explosives, attempted to breach the facility. Following an explosion at the entrance, they engaged in a shootout, leading to significant casualties among security personnel.
It is suspected that at least one attacker remains at large, possibly holding hostages inside. The incident has raised serious concerns regarding security at crucial defense infrastructure, especially amidst the backdrop of the ongoing BRICS summit involving Turkish President Erdoğan.
Turkish authorities are currently conducting operations in response to the attack, and security forces, including special units, have been deployed to the area.
Military Situation in Eastern Ukraine:
The ongoing conflict in Ukraine remains intense, with reports of 79 combat incidents recorded across various regions today.
Russian forces are making significant advances southward in areas like Selidovo and Izmaylovka, effectively cutting off supply routes to Ukrainian forces in surrounding regions, particularly affecting Gornyak.
Ukrainian defenses continue to resist multifaceted assaults despite the high pressure, with localized counterattacks being observed, particularly in high-density areas.

International Support Dynamics:
Ukrainian forces are receiving increased military support, with the UK pledging an additional £120 million in aid to bolster naval capabilities amid threats to Ukrainian ports.
Concerns are being raised regarding North Korean military support for Russia, with preliminary reports indicating 3,000 military personnel have already been sent to Russia to assist in the Ukraine conflict.
